Runbook: canary gating for the Ledgerline API. Canary traffic starts at 5% and is promoted only when error rate stays under 0.5% for fifteen minutes; the gate controller enforces this automatically. As a contractor, you will not change the thresholds, but you must ensure the controller can authenticate to the metrics store. Its credential is set by the line directly below.

vault entry, yahif-yajep: COURIER_KEY29=b802bdf8034096b65a51c6ba5abe2

### Audit item 14: Component library versioning

New folks: check that every release of the Thimbleset UI library bumped its version per semver and tagged the changelog. If a breaking change snuck out as a patch, flag it — it happens more than you'd think. Don't guess on edge cases; just ask. The person who signs off on versioning questions is listed here.

signatory, yagap-bawig: Ulaath Eliath

## v3.8.0 — Setting renamed

The log-sampling knob for the notoriously chatty Pigeonhole dispatch service has been renamed from `PH_LOG_RATE` to `PH_LOG_SAMPLE_RATIO` to make clear it is a 0–1 ratio, not events per second. Reviewers should confirm that every deployment manifest migrated the key; the old name is now ignored silently, which previously caused full-volume logging in the Harwick cluster. Sampled logs are shipped to the Lanternview collector, which authenticates via a token that must appear on the next line of the env file.

secret setting of yafof-tawep: RELAY_SECRET8=8abb5772

The renewal of our three-year agreement with Torvane Materials has been assessed in detail. Proposed terms include a 4.2% unit-price increase, partially offset by improved volume rebates and extended payment terms of sixty days. Sensitivity analysis indicates a net annual cost impact of under 1% on the Meridia product line, assuming stable demand. Legal has flagged no material changes to liability clauses. We recommend approval, subject to the conditions outlined in the confidential note below.

confidential, yawip-bahif: Zorokox Partners plans to lower the Casax list price by 28.0 percent in April. The board signed off on a budget of $271.0 million for Project Juldor. The renewal with Pelokox Partners closes at $410.1 million a year, 3.4 percent below the last contract. Project Pelok slips by a full year because of the audit delay.